You have been invited to Brooklyn, New York; the hometown of many legendary MC’s such as the Notorious B.I.G, Jay-Z, Talib Kweli, and Mos Def. This invitation is offering you the opportunity for an exclusive look into a next chapter in hip-hop to come out of Brooklyn by way of Hartford, Connecticut. That name is Mike Slim and with the name comes a refreshing air to a hip-hop community often plagued by violence, materialism, and misogyny. Heavily influenced by greats like Mos Def, Jay-Z, Kanye West and the late great TuPac Shakur, Mike Slim aspires to follow in those large footsteps in more ways than one. He says, "My dream is to become a mass appealing and influential artist for more than just the typical glitz and glam of it all." "It’s like becoming rich to in turn share that wealth".

After moving to the Bronx in the late nineties to pursue a higher education, he became obsessed with getting an extracurricular education in the art form of hip-hop. “I was in the hometown of hip-hop, so the transition came very naturally. All the elements of the culture were right there in my face, so I went from being a spectator on the outside looking in, to more of a participant” says Slim. While Mike Slim believed his talent would stand up to the best of them, his background remained unique to most rappers. Unfortunately its not common to find a brotha in hip hop with a college degree and limited tales of hustling to solidify his street cred. "I can definitely say I didn’t live a sheltered life growing up.” Slim says. "I think my upbringing gave me a more well rounded experience if anything because I was able to see both sides of the fence." Hopefully this rounded experience enables Mike to reach a versatile audience.

In his short career, Mike Slim has already completed a soon to be published children’s book, independently released a full length album and mixtape and led a hip-hip trio and band with polished performances all over the tri-state area. Ultimately Mike Slim has ended up in Brooklyn, home of the greats, where he plans to join those ranks through his positive and fresh approach to hip-hop.
